During the Halloween season, Spirit operates over 1,400 store locations in North America. The Spirit Halloween website is open year-round, offering its in-store products online. The stores are usually open for 30 or 60 days prior to Halloween.

Joe Marver created the Spirit Halloween business model, a pop-up store catering to Halloween revelers. Starting with his first pop-up location in the Castro Valley Mall in 1984, he grew Spirit Halloween to 60 seasonal stores nationwide before it was acquired in 1999. His approach to short-term leases, locations, and the stocking of widely varied merchandise was novel in the Halloween retail sector.

Filippo’s Italian Specialties at 1226 Triangle Ln in Wheaton has been listed for sale. The store tells us that the deli is in great standing and the reason for the sale is that “Filippo is just ready to retire.”   Filippo’s, which operated as Marchone’s until 2014, opened in 1955.  Current owner Filippo Leo has worked at the deli for over 35 years and took over ownership back in 2012, a year after founder Thomas Marchone passed away. In 2020, Filippo’s won the TasteMoCo tournament for “Best Deli” in Montgomery County, beating out 31 other delis that had all been nominated by readers of the MoCoShow to win the award.

On Wednesday,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ration  authorized the Moderna and Pfizer-BioNTech Bivalent COVID-19 vaccines to be used as a booster dose. According to the FDA, these vaccines “include an mRNA component of the original strain to provide an immune response that is broadly protective against COVID-19 and an mRNA component in common between the omicron variant BA.4 and BA.5 lineages to provide better protection against COVID-19 caused by the omicron variant.”
